(In reply to comment #15)
> * Long term: Modify references to not be hardcoded in the main html output,
> so that this doesn't matter anymore and it is all handled by ResourceLoader
> instead. For images that means css, for scripts that means mw.loader.load,
> and for the csshover file... well, I guess we could maybe set 
> $wgLocalStylePath
> to the generic /skins/ symlink that points to one of the HET-deployed versions
> (may not be the right version though). Or perhaps make it so that the docroot
> /w of each wiki is pointing to the correct php dir). Anyway, that's long term
> idealism.

This seems like a sensible approach. Why is it long term idealism, though?
